Yesterday on the Senate floor Ted Cruz introduced bipartisan legislation that would ensure our military will get their paychecks should a government shutdown happen next week. But Democrats objected, refusing to allow unanimous consent for the bill to be passed.

Here’s the very short version posted by the GOP:

Loading a Tweet...

 
What is interesting about this is that Cruz said last week he introduced similar bipartisan legislation, except it was only aimed at the Coast Guard because they are under Homeland Security and not under DOD. But Senator Pat Murray from Washington state claimed she was objecting because the bill didn’t cover the entire military.

So yesterday Ted Cruz did what she asked and crafted bipartisan legislation for the entire military to be paid in the event of a government shutdown. And she still objected, as you see above.
